#define MATRIX_ROWS 8
#define MATRIX_COLS 16
-#define DIODE_DIRECTION CUSTOM_MATRIX
+//#define DIODE_DIRECTION
/* define if matrix has ghost */
//#define MATRIX_HAS_GHOST
// #define BACKLIGHT_PIN B7
/* Set 0 if debouncing isn't needed */
-#define DEBOUNCING_DELAY 0
+#define DEBOUNCE 0
#define TAPPING_TERM 175
/* Mechanical locking support. Use KC_LCAP, KC_LNUM or KC_LSCR instead in keymap */
/* Locking resynchronize hack */
// #define LOCKING_RESYNC_ENABLE
-/* key combination for command */
-#define IS_COMMAND() ( \
- keyboard_report->mods == (MOD_BIT(KC_LSHIFT) | MOD_BIT(KC_RSHIFT)) \
-)
-
-
-
/*
* Feature disable options
* These options are also useful to firmware size reduction.
*/
+#define USE_I2C
+
/* disable debug print */
//#define NO_DEBUG
//#define NO_ACTION_MACRO
//#define NO_ACTION_FUNCTION
+// higher value means deeper actuation point, less sensitive
+// be careful and only make small adjustments (steps of 1 or 2).
+// too high and keys will fail to actuate. too low and keys will actuate spontaneously.
+// test all keys before further adjustment.
+// this should probably stay in the range +/-5.
+// #define ACTUATION_DEPTH_ADJUSTMENT 0
+
#endif